Female Winners of the 2018 London, Berlin, Chicago and New York City Marathons to Race 2019 London MarathonBy Adam Kopet Vivian Cheruiyot will attempt to defend her 2018 Virgin Money London Marathon win at the 2019 edition of the race April 28, according to race organizers.
Cheruiyot was a surprise winner in 2018 after a fast early pace set by Mary Keitany proved to be too fast on the day when warmer than average temperatures impacted many of the athletes. Keitany returns to London this year, as well as the winners of the 2018 Berlin and Chicago Marathons, Gladys Cherono and Brigid Kosgei, respectively.
Also in the field is Tirunesh Dibaba, the third-fastest woman of all-time in the marathon. These five women have all run under 2:19, making the 2019 London Marathon the deepest women's field ever assembled.
